Why has "CityPopulations" been removed from gameoptions.txt?

I like to play Survival and Genocide games with "Totally Random" and would like to do so with this mod installed.

What ill effects will I encounter if I add this option back myself?

FYI, this mod is pretty dull with every city having an identical population.

All that was done for the mod was editing of the existing cities file, so any superficial oddness to the naming system is down to IV, not the creator of the mod.
